The 10t/h Biochar Double Roller Extrusion Pelletizer is a state-of-the-art machine designed to convert biochar powder into uniform pellets. This pelletizer offers several key features:
- High Capacity: Capable of producing 10 tons of biochar pellets per hour, making it suitable for large-scale farming operations.
- Efficiency: Utilizes a double roller extrusion mechanism to ensure high pellet quality and consistency.
- Energy Efficiency: Designed to minimize energy consumption while maximizing output.
- Ease of Use: Features an intuitive interface and robust construction for easy operation and maintenance.
